Yoga and Dance: A Festival of Movement and Mindfulness

In expanding the universe, we are ourselves miniature universes. Consciously, we are expanding, expanding, expanding, expanding, expanding, expanding, expanding, expanding, expanding.
Ever thought about combining the grace of dance with the mindfulness of yoga? In this episode of Yoga Radio Sessions, hosts Christian Wigardt and Curt Lundberg sit down with JoJo and Angelica, the dynamic duo behind Stockholm's Yoga & Dance Festival. For five years, they've been creating a space where movement and meditation meet, offering a unique blend of physical and mental well-being. Curious about what to expect? Think beyond the stereotypical patchouli-scented gatherings.
This festival is a vibrant mix of diverse people and practices, all united by a love for yoga and dance. Music plays a pivotal role too, adding rhythm to the flow and enhancing the overall experience. The conversation touches on the transformative power of these combined practices. JoJo and Angelica share how yoga and dance have helped many people connect more deeply with their bodies and minds.
They also discuss how these activities can be powerful tools for overcoming substance abuse and integrating personal training. The episode is sprinkled with discussions on acroyoga, raw food, and yoga teacher training, showing just how versatile yoga can be. The hosts and guests also touch on broader themes like personal growth and individuality, reminding us that we're all expanding universes in our own right.
